SLB Limited $SLB Shares Bought by Kentucky Retirement Systems

Kentucky Retirement Systems raised its position in shares of SLB Limited (NYSE:SLBFree Report) by 15.5% in the first qu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 108,730 shares of the oil and gas company’s stock after acquiring an additional 14,563 shares during the quarter. Kentucky Retirement Systems’ holdings in SLB were worth $5,588,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

SLB (NYSE:SLBG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Saturday, July 25th. The oil and gas company reported $0.55 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.51 by $0.04. The company had revenue of $8.97 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$8.67 billion. SLB had a net margin of 8.53% and a return on equity of 14.05%. SLB’s quarterly revenue was up 5.0%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the firm earned $0.74 earnings per share. Sell-side analysts forecast that SLB Limited will post 2.49 EPS for the current year.

SLB Dividend Announcement

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, October 8th. Stockholders of record on Wednesday, September 2nd will be given a dividend of $0.295 per share. This represents a $1.18 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.4%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Wednesday, September 2nd. SLB’s payout ratio is presently 57.00%.

SLB (NYSE: SLB), historically known as Schlumberger, is a leading global provider of technology, integrated project management and information solutions for the energy industry. Founded by Conrad and Marcel Schlumberger in 1926, the company develops and supplies products and services used across the exploration, drilling, completion and production phases of oil and gas development. Its offerings are intended to help operators characterize reservoirs, drill and complete wells, optimize production and manage field operations throughout the asset lifecycle.

SLB’s product and service portfolio spans reservoir characterization and well testing, wireline and logging services, directional drilling and drilling tools, well construction and completion technologies, production systems, and subsea equipment.
